
As the film groups Contracts Manager and Paralegal, Gabriella Ludlow provides a variety of services to producers, production companies and the firms individual clients. Her responsibilities include negotiating various below the line agreements, reviewing film production guild applications, and consulting with producers and their production staff in the areas of rights clearances, product placement and set location agreements.
Ms. Ludlow came to the film and media industry after many years in the music industry where she held such positions as Associate Director of the business affairs department at Sony Music Special Products (now SonyBMG Custom Marketing Group) and as Manager of the copyright departments at Arista Records and BMG Music Group.
Prior to joining Epstein, Levinsohn, Bodine, Hurwitz & Weinstein, LLP full time in 2005, Ms. Ludlow served as a consultant to the firm as well as several other entertainment industry clients such as EMI Music, Sony Music Group and Turner Networks Group. She has also served as a guest lecturer on music copyright and licensing issues at Columbia College in Chicago.
Ms. Ludlow received her BA from New York University and lives in Manhattan with her husband.
